6x6 Ceramic field tile, over slab the stuff is really meant for the walls not floors although I have seen it used on floors.
There were some chips and some damage but I have cleaned them before. The bathroom next to it had no prob same tile and cleaned the same way. I fixed it today, pulled up bucked tiles cleaned them and reset them. As you can imagine if I was able to reset the same tiles they must of not been bonded to well and that was the case. No cement or thinset on the backs of these tile. I believe that the heat and the absorbed water caused tile to swell. The lack of a good bond was a contributing factor. The facilities manager was with me on my assumption and told us to bill them for the repair. He was very happy that we steped up and fixed the problem quickly. They know now that the tile is not for use on floors and now understand why they have so many chiped tiles in both bathrooms and to plan on replacing in near future.
